Marcia Belsky is a comedian and musician who transforms everyday absurdities into thought-provoking entertainment. She gained recognition for her unique approach to commentary through musical comedy, tackling subjects that range from scientific mishaps to broader social observations.
Her work demonstrates how humor can be used as a vehicle to examine the peculiarities of modern life and institutional decision-making. Belsky's performance style combines musical talent with sharp observational comedy, creating content that is both entertaining and intellectually engaging.
Her ability to find humor in unexpected places - such as NASA's planning oversights - showcases her talent for identifying the absurd elements that exist within serious institutions and everyday situations. Through her performances, she invites audiences to reconsider familiar topics through a lens of creative irreverence.
